P458 KBC is a 1997 Mazda Bongo in Green with a 2,500c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.

Across all 1997 Mazda Bongo models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.3% with a typical mileage of 131,832 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Mazda Bongo fails its MOT is fog lamp not working, accounting for 6,854 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P458 KBC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da Bongo typ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 29 years old, this Mazda Bongo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
